Good afternoon. I've found that, even with SU10 Navdata API enabled, I can't make GSX recognize the correct parking spots. This is a trial I did with SimulaciĆ³n Extrema SACO, purchased at the Marketplace:

I loaded a flight in Gate 5, and then requested GSX to reposition my aircraft. These are the results:

- Requested Gate 6, ended up somewhere close to Gate 1.
- Requested Gate 5, ended up in Gate 3.
- Requested Gate 4, ended up in Gate 7.
- Requested Gate 2, ended up back in Gate 5.

Crosschecking with Aivlasoft EFB (which can't read Marketplace airports), I find I was sent to the default parking positions. I'm having a similar situation with SierraSim SKBG, also from Marketplace. This may not matter during departure, but at arrival I can't select the gate correctly. Am I expecting too much, understanding the API wrong, or wasn't the SU 10 Navdata API supposed to detect the correct parking positions?

Please see the attached log, and screenshots of MSFS and the EFB showing the position differences. Am I doing something wrong?

You don't say if you have a custom GSX profile you made for that airport you made or downloaded, of you have a GSX custom profile for that airport in general because:

- When the Navdata API is in use, GSX cannot automatically load a profile based on the .BGL in use, because there's no .BGL in use, so it's your responsibility the custom profile is made for that scenery.

- Even if the custom profile was supposedly made for that scenery, if it was made before GSX supported the Navdata, it's possible ( I've seen tutorial explaining this ) the creator might have done it in a way to trick GSX that was loading the default .BGL, by using the default .BGL parking names, and tweaking their positions to match the addon scenery. This method is very unreliable and, of course, when GSX used the Navdata, is completely useless and in fact might just cause the problem you are reporting.

So, first, to be sure GSX is really using the Navdata correctly, remove any custom GSX profiles you might have made/downloaded for that airport from the %APPDATA%\Virtuali\GSX\MSFS folder.

Yes, and it shows you are not using the SU10 Navdata API, because when you do, the name of the .BGL won't appear in the airport customization page.
